Transaction 90ddf7c26facfbc72e2b847a6f2670634ebf538fcaba7f2fe92345af5eb72f65
1 Input
1 Output
-
90ddf7c26facfbc72e2b847a6f2670634ebf538fcaba7f2fe92345af5eb72f65:0
- value
- 79974592
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1392fa8c45797b67d996cc17680bb7f5aca3c75 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HA57KUyFCuaUbGdsQfu4F8MHeETQZTMSS